Steffen Disch (born February 26, 1972 in Freiburg im Breisgau ) is a German star and television chef.

Life

Disch started his training at the Colombi Hotel in Freiburg with Alfred Klink from 1989 to 1992 . He then worked at the Bamberger Reiter in Berlin (1994–1996), the Hotel Königshof (1997–1998) and the Tantris Restaurant (1999–2000) in Munich and as a chef at the Forsthaus Ilkahöhe in Tutzing (2000–2002) and in Ifen Hotel in the Kleinwalsertal (2002-2004).

Steffen Disch has been the owner and chef de cuisine at Raben in Horben near Freiburg since May 2005 . There, his culinary art is mainly a regionally inspired gourmet cuisine.

Disch was accepted into the group of Jeunes Restaurateurs d'Europe (JRE) in 2007, seven years later he was awarded a Michelin star . Disch has often been seen on television. The "AufgeDischt" format has existed since 2017.
